I'm really lazy so I would put the story when we search Darling in The Franxx on French Wikipedia : In the distant and dystopian future, the surface of the Earth has become arid, inhospitable and dangerous to humans, continually targeted by wild beasts called “howlers”. By sheltering in gigantic air-conditioned mobile domes, called plantations, and by arming themselves with powerful combat robots, called "FranXX", they nevertheless manage to face the difficulties. The men are led by the Seven Sages and APE, an organization of scientists whose supreme leader is called “Papa”. Their army is made up of young soldiers, called Parasites, who are designed, educated, and selected solely for the purpose of fighting. With this in mind, they must synchronize by forming pistil-stamen pairs (girl-boy). They are kept in total ignorance of what is not related to their mission: to defend adults, until their last breath.

So, the message hidden at the start of the anime, and which I personally found super interesting was that: Darling in the Franxx is indeed a critique of the absurdity of today's technological society which only has a short-term view, not concerned with the happiness of its elements and constantly seeking efficiency, even complexity. abusive. It is also a work proud of the qualities that make men: selflessness, determination, reason, compassion and passion. All these emotions are symbolized by the main couple, who brings them together and shares them with all those who wish to follow their example. We also see the impact of transhumanism, very present in the work, which is presented sometimes in a negative way, sometimes in a positive way according to its use and its creator (the Franxx, the autonomous cities, the framework of science fiction ...) . Let's talk first the similarities of Evangelion : Hiro. The protagonist is a pure copy of Shinji : they both are depressed, they reject others then they finally accept the others, they both are "special" to ride the robots, etc etc... Zero Two is a mixture between Rei (for her very mysterious side then revealed later in the anime) and Asuka (for her side of taking people from above and also being a bit like "depressed"). Then the universe : Evangelion is a mecha post-apocalyptic world, they both fight "Angels", they need only kids to ride the robots, they also have a "berserker mod", etc etc....
